#b72ac8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b72ac8 is composed of 71.8% red, 16.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 79%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 293.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#b72ac8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ff54ff with #6f0091.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#b72ac8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b72ac8 has RGB values of R:183, G:42,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12004040.

Shades and Tints of #b72ac8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fd is the lightest one.
